Product Overview

Category

The MMA6826AKGCWR2 belongs to the category of motion sensors, specifically an accelerometer.

Use

It is used for measuring acceleration and tilt in various electronic devices and applications.

Characteristics

  • High sensitivity
  • Low power consumption
  • Compact size
  • Wide measurement range

Package

The MMA6826AKGCWR2 is available in a small surface-mount package, making it suitable for integration into compact electronic devices.

Essence

The essence of this product lies in its ability to accurately measure acceleration and tilt, enabling precise motion detection in electronic devices.

Packaging/Quantity

The MMA6826AKGCWR2 is typically packaged in reels and is available in varying quantities based on customer requirements.

Specifications

  • Measurement Range: ±2g, ±4g, ±8g, ±16g
  • Output Type: Digital (I2C/SPI)
  • Operating Voltage: 1.71V to 3.6V
  • Operating Temperature Range: -40°C to +85°C
  • Dimensions: 3mm x 3mm x 0.9mm

Working Principles

The MMA6826AKGCWR2 operates based on the principles of microelectromechanical systems (MEMS) technology, where the movement of microscopic structures within the sensor generates electrical signals proportional to the applied acceleration.
